  • Покаянная традиция —  ♦ (ENG penitential tradition)    традиция, к рая демонстрирует важность раскаяния и прощения грехов, совершенных после христианского крещения. Она просматривается в римско католическом (и православном) таинстве покаяния (см. Покаяния таинство),… …   Вестминстерский словарь теологических терминов
